*Paper Development Workshops*
*AIB US Southeast, **November 12**–14, 2015*


Dear Colleagues,


AIB-SE is excited to announce that this year's conference will feature two
paper development workshops for future special issues of *International
Marketing Review* and *Cross-Cultural Management*. Please see additional
details below.


AIB-SE is partnering with the *International Marketing Review Special
issue** on
The International Marketing - Supply Chain Management & Logistics
Interface.*

This
special issue (SI) was developed around the conference theme.  Papers that
are submitted to the conference, and that are approved as having a
potential fit with the SI, will be invited to a paper development workshop
that is being run at the conference venue in November. The submission
deadline for the special issue is February 28, 2016 so there is time to
take advantage of these sessions in November at AIB SE 2015 to ready
submissions for this issue. Working papers are welcome as submissions to
the conference; *manuscripts should be submitted via the *AIB-SE online
submission system <http://meetings.aib.msu.edu/us-se/2014/>* by July 15,
2015. Contact Peter Magnusson *[log in to unmask] *with any questions
regarding the IMR SI.*



AIB-SE is also partnering with *Cross Cultural Management (CCM) Special
Issue on Gender in International Business/Management*

*. * In addition to the opportunity to submit your paper to this special
issue, there is a track in the conference for papers exploring Gender in
International Business including a paper development workshop to help
authors polish there work in this area, and a panel session along with
competitive and interactive sessions.  Papers that are submitted to the
conference, and that are approved as having a potential fit with the SI,
will be invited to a paper development workshop that is being run at the
conference.  The submission deadline for the special issue is February 15,
2016 so there is time to take advantage of these sessions in November at
AIB SE 2015 to ready submissions for this issue. *Working papers are
welcome as submissions to the conference; manuscripts should be submitted
via the *AIB-SE online submission system
<http://meetings.aib.msu.edu/us-se/2014/>* by July 15, 2015.  Contact Susan
Forquer Gupta *[log in to unmask]* with any questions regarding the CCM
SI.*
